Here's what actually drives the cost of a Water Damage Restoration job in Anna, explained plainly before you ever get a bill.
The biggest factor is usually the source and category of water involved. Clean water from a supply line costs less to remediate than contaminated water from a sewage backup, which requires additional sanitizing and, in some cases, disposal of porous materials that can't be safely dried. The size of the affected area and how long the water sat before extraction also play a major role.
Materials matter too — hardwood floors, plaster walls, and built-in cabinetry generally cost more to restore than standard drywall and carpet. We walk through all of this on-site before any work begins, so the number you're given reflects your actual Anna property, not a generic estimate.

A shop vac and a couple of fans can make a Anna property look dry on the surface — but "looks dry" and "is actually dry" are two different things.
The visible water on your Anna floor is often only part of the problem. Water wicks upward into drywall and travels along subfloor seams into wall cavities a rented fan will never reach. Without professional dehumidification, hidden dampness can sit for weeks, quietly feeding mold growth long after the surface feels dry.
Insurance carriers generally want documented proof a loss was properly mitigated. A DIY cleanup rarely produces that record, which can leave Anna homeowners exposed if related damage surfaces months down the road.

Our Anna trucks carry truck-mounted extraction units, low-grain-refrigerant dehumidifiers, high-velocity air movers, and moisture meters that read behind walls without cutting into them.
A rental-store fan moves air across a surface. Our dehumidification setup actively pulls moisture out of building materials, cutting drying time from weeks down to days on most Anna jobs.
